
ARM Cortex-M_ARM Cortex-M是什么意思
2024-06-07 10:12:06
晨欣小编
ARM Cortex-M是一款由ARM(Advanced RISC Machines)公司推出的低功耗、低成本、高性能的嵌入式微处理器。ARM Cortex-M系列微处理器广泛应用于各种嵌入式系统,如智能手机、平板电脑、工业控制系统等。ARM Cortex-M处理器采用RISC(Reduced Instruction Set Computing)架构,具有高性能和低功耗的特点,适用于对功耗和成本要求较高的应用场景。
ARM Cortex-M系列微处理器分为三个级别,包括Cortex-M0、Cortex-M3和Cortex-M4。其中,Cortex-M0是一款针对低成本、低功耗应用场景设计的微处理器,适用于一些对性能要求不高的小型嵌入式系统。Cortex-M3是一款具有较高性能和较高功耗的微处理器,适用于一些对性能和功耗要求较高的嵌入式系统。Cortex-M4是一款在Cortex-M3基础上进行了增强的微处理器,新增了DSP(Digital Signal Processing)指令集和浮点运算单元,适用于对信号处理要求较高的应用场景。
ARM Cortex-M系列微处理器具有丰富的外设接口和功能模块,包括通用输入输出引脚、定时器、串口、SPI(Serial Peripheral Interface)、I2C(Inter-Integrated Circuit)等,支持多种外部设备和传感器的连接。此外,ARM Cortex-M系列微处理器还支持内部存储器和外部存储器的接口,方便存储和处理大量数据。
总的来说,ARM Cortex-M系列微处理器是一款性能优越、功耗低、成本低的嵌入式微处理器,适用于各种嵌入式系统的开发和应用。其灵活的外设接口和丰富的功能模块使得开发人员可以根据不同的应用需求进行定制,满足不同场景的需求。ARM Cortex-M的推出为嵌入式系统的发展提供了强有力的支持,促进了智能设备和物联网的快速发展和普及。